在设计师独立开发iOS app过程中寻找靠谱的外包程序员关键在于明确项目需求、仔细筛选候选人、确保良好沟通和明确合同条款。首先,你需要清楚地定义你的app项目要求和预期功能,这有利于在面试过程中向候选人明确你的期望。接下来,通过专业平台如Upwork、Freelancer等进行筛选,查看每位候选人的历史评价、技能认证和过往工作样本来判断其是否能够满足你的开发需求。
一、定义项目需求和目标
在寻找外包程序员前,首先得确立详细的项目需求。这包括app的目标功能、用户界面设计、预期的用户体验以及任何特殊技术需求,如第三方服务集成或者后端服务器支持。对项目需求的清晰界定是高效沟通的基石,并能帮助程序员更好地理解工作任务。
- 提出明确的功能列表和技术要求,确保你期望的每个细节都被纳入开发范围。这将有助于外包程序员评估其技能是否匹配和预估项目完成时间。
- 考虑到app的设计和用户体验是优先级,明确哪些是核心功能,哪些是次要的或可后期添加,从而保持开发过程的聚焦和效率。
二、筛选候选人和评估技能
寻找合适的外包程序员要通过一系列筛选过程。在专业外包平台发布项目,同时检查程序员的技能、经验和信誉度。专业经验和技能认证通常是衡量外包程序员是否靠谱的重要指标。
- 查看候选人之前的工作案例和客户评价,尤其是那些与你的项目类似的案例。好的评价和成功案例往往预示着靠谱的合作伙伴。
- 面试过程中测试其技术能力,通过技术测试或者要求解决一些常见问题,可以帮助你评估候选人是否有能力承担当前的开发任务。
三、良好沟通及管理预期
沟通是远程合作成功的关键,设计师要和程序员建立起定期和高效的沟通机制。确保合作期间你们可以持续同步信息,以便及时解决可能出现的问题。
- 建立起定期的进度报告制度和沟通机制,例如每周的视频会议或者工作进度报告,这有助于紧密跟踪项目进度,并及时调整项目方向。
- 使用项目管理工具如Jira或Trello,将项目分解成多个小任务和里程碑,可以让进度变得可量化和更加透明,便于管理预期。
四、明确合同和条款
在合同中明确规定工作范围、时间线、付款安排以及任何版权或知识产权的转让条款是非常关键的。这将为合作提供法律框架并保护双方的权益。
- 在合同中详细列出所有交付物以及每个阶段需要完成的任务,确保程序员清楚工作范围和期望。
- 使用里程碑支付机制,在重要阶段完成后再支付相应的款项,以此激励程序员按时交付高质量的工作成果。
通过这些步骤,设计师可以以最大的可能性找到符合自己项目需求的靠谱外包程序员,使app项目顺利进行。记住,良好的开始是成功的一半,因此在寻找外包程序员的过程中投入足够的时间和精力是非常值得的。
相关问答FAQs:
如何找到合适的外包程序员帮助设计师开发iOS应用?
-
在哪些平台可以寻找可靠的外包程序员?
您可以在一些知名的在线平台上寻找合适的外包程序员,如Upwork、Freelancer、Toptal等。这些平台聚集了大量的有经验的开发者,您可以根据他们的个人资料、项目经历和评价来评估他们的能力和可靠性。 -
如何评估外包程序员的能力和专业素养?
在雇佣外包程序员之前,可以要求他们提供他们的作品和项目经验。您可以查看他们的应用程序示例,并与之交谈,了解他们的开发流程、技术和解决问题的能力。此外,您也可以参考他们的客户评价和推荐信来评估他们的可靠性和表现。 -
有什么方法可以确保从外包程序员那里得到高质量的开发成果?
首先,与外包程序员达成明确的沟通和共识,确保双方对项目需求和目标有清晰的了解。其次,与程序员签订正式的合同或协议,明确双方的责任和权利。还可以要求程序员按阶段提交工作成果,并进行及时的反馈和审查。此外,保持良好的沟通和合作也是确保高质量成果的关键因素之一。